JERVOISE, Harry Samuel Gumming Clarke was born on April 2, 1832.
Harrow; Merton College, Oxford. A Clerk in Foreign Office, 1070 1854-1894.
Attached to Viscount Sydney’s special mission to Brussels, 1866. Private Secretary to late Mr Egerton when Parliamentary Secretary for Foreign affairs, 1866-1868. Acting 2nd Secretary in diplomatic service, 1868.
Appointed to serve in British Legation in Florence. Temporarily transferred to Rome to assist Mr. Odo Russell, afterwards Lord Ampthill, 1870, on whose departure he remained on special service at Rome, 1870-1874. 5th Baronet., cartulary-register 1813.
Club: Arthur’s.
Spouse 1874, Beatrice Evelyn, d, of late Wm. Bruce Stopford Sackville of Drayton House, Northants. Heir: n. Eustace James Clarke Jervoise.
